Episode 37

Sulaiman is pressured by Salmah to quickly start a family while she and Nadiah have to deal with the pressures of extra expenses when their water heater breaks down. Meanwhile, Norleena who's been feeling under the weather finds out the real reason behind it which ultimately will cause more expenses in the Rahman household. Xue Ling tries to find an investor for Adam's business venture but it doesn't sit well with Adam when she uses the Lim name to sell the business. Frustrated, Adam makes a decision about his business that could ultimately cause friction between husband and wife. Eddie wants to earn more money as an escort but can't seem to get enough jobs. He seeks advice from Mark who plainly tells him that being an escort is not an easy job and that he has to up his game if he wants to flourish in the business. Will Eddie be able to rise through the ranks?
